Five guys. One bar. And a whole heap of sexy trouble...

Sawyer Landry is sexy, rugged, charming… and did I mention sexy? Back in college, we were best of friends - which meant I secretly hid an epic unrequited crush, while he dated every other girl on campus… and then told me all about it the morning after.

Now I’m back in Chicago for the first time in years, and Sawyer is determined to rekindle our friendship. I swore, I wouldn’t put my life (and heart) on hold for him again, but just one look at his handsome face and I know, he’s still the only man for me.

But this time, things are going to be different. No more sitting around, waiting for him to realize his dream woman is right in front of him. No, I’m going to make him see, I’m not just one of the guys anymore.

But can I really go from sidekick to soulmate? And will this playboy bachelor realize, true love is waiting - if he’d only take a chance?

AUTHOR BIO

Katie McCoy is a self-proclaimed sushi addict, Cardinals baseball fanatic, and lover of all things theatrical. A St. Louis native transplanted to Brooklyn, she acts, sings, and shakes her booty when she isn't writing books about hot men and the girls who love them.

It’s Sawyer’s turn in the hot seat!

I love this series so far and I’ve been looking forward to reading Sawyer’s story. This man caught my attention early on (how could he not?!) and I am definitely not disappointed.

This guy is ALL man. He's rugged, charming, and really good with his hands (and I don't mean just in the bedroom). He's flirty, funny, easy on the eyes, and way too easy on the heart. He'd be perfect if it wasn't for that pesky fear of commitment thing.

You can’t help but have sympathy for Gabi. She’s had a rough few months, but I love how she doesn’t let it get her down though. And when she’s reunited with Sawyer, I love seeing her finally go after what she wants.

Put these two together and sparks fly. They’re quirky and fun, but also awkward and adorable. And for those of us who have been following along with the series, we get plenty of updates on our past couples. Only one more book to go and I can’t wait to see what happens next.
